| | Internet Explorer Zoom lets you enlarge or reduce the view of a webpage. Unlike changing font size, zoom enlarges or reduces everything on the page, including text and images. You can zoom from 10% to 1000%. Click to open Internet Explorer. On the bottom right of the Internet Explorer screen, click the arrow next to the Change Zoom Level button . To go to a predefined zoom level, click the percentage of enlargement or reduction you want. - or - To specify a custom level, click Custom. In the Percentage zoom box, type a zoom value, and then click OK. | | | |

| | that is why my husband doesn't do anything on the computer. If you have a mouse with a wheel, hold down the CTRL key, and then scroll the wheel to zoom in or out. If you click the Change Zoom Level button , it will cycle through 100%, 125%, and 150%, giving you a quick enlargement of the webpage. From the keyboard you can increase or decrease the zoom value in 10% increments. To zoom in, press CTRL+(+). To zoom out, press CTRL+(-). To restore the zoom to 100%, press CTRL+0. maybe you can use the keyboard to ecrease the size. But to answer another part of the question, Right-click on the desktop, go to display settings, and pick a higher resolution with as many colors as you want (16-bit and 32-bit give you the most colors). The higher resolution (1440 by 900, for example) will put more "stuff" on your screen (i.e., things will look smaller, but you'll see more), whereas a lower resolution (640 by 480) will make things bigger, but you won't see as much. | | | | | | |

| | What if you just reset to default settings? Here are instructions on how... To reset Internet Explorer to the default settings Close any Internet Explorer or Windows Explorer windows that are currently open. Open Internet Explorer. Click the Tools button, and then click Internet Options. Click the Advanced tab, and then click Reset. In the Reset Internet Explorer Settings dialog box, click Reset. When Internet Explorer finishes restoring the default settings, click Close, and then click OK. Close Internet Explorer. The changes will take effect the next time you open Internet Explorer. | | | |
